Biography

Early Life before Ptolus:

Kirk Mudhallow was born on the 23rd of Moons in the rugged, open expanse of the Plains of Nall, a region known for its wide grasslands and nomadic tribes. His tribe, the Moonhowlers, was a tight-knit group of gnolls known for their exceptional physical prowess and fierce loyalty to one another.

Growing up, Kirk was immersed in the traditions of his people, learning the ways of hunting, tracking, and, most importantly, combat.

Kirk's father, Grok Mudhallow, was a respected warrior and a master of wrestling. He taught Kirk the importance of honor, discipline, and the strength needed to protect one's kin.

Kirk showed great promise, quickly mastering the martial techniques and earning a reputation as a formidable wrestler as a child.

As Kirk Mudhallow grew under the guidance of his father Grok, he embraced the rugged lifestyle of the Moonhowler tribe with fervor. His childhood on the Plains of Nall was a tapestry of wide skies and endless grasslands, where every day presented new challenges and lessons in survival.

From an early age, Kirk displayed a natural affinity for physical activities, excelling in the martial traditions of his tribe. Wrestling, in particular, became his passion and a skill at which he swiftly excelled. Under Grok's tutelage, Kirk honed his technique, learning the art of grappling, leverage, and the importance of strength tempered with strategy.

The Moonhowlers valued not just physical prowess but also a deep bond of loyalty among their members. Kirk grew up surrounded by his extended family, where the concept of tribe transcended bloodlines to encompass a shared commitment to mutual support and protection. This environment instilled in Kirk a strong sense of community and duty towards his people.

Beyond combat skills, Kirk learned the essential skills of survival on the plains while understanding the rhythms of nature that dictated their nomadic way of life. He became adept at reading signs in the landscapes.

As he matured, Kirk's reputation as a skilled wrestler spread beyond the confines of his tribe. His victories in local competitions not only brought honor to the Moonhowlers but also garnered respect. His prowess in combat became a source of pride for his family and a symbol of resilience for his people in a harsh and unpredictable environment.

However, life on the Plains of Nall was not without its challenges. The nomadic lifestyle meant constant vigilance against natural hazards, rival tribes, and occasional conflicts over resources. Kirk witnessed firsthand the harsh realities of survival, including the loss of loved ones and the sacrifices made to ensure the tribe's continued existence.

Throughout these formative years, Kirk's character was shaped by the teachings of his father and the experiences shared with his tribe. He learned the value of perseverance in the face of adversity, the importance of loyalty to those who stand beside him, and the duty to use his skills not just for personal gain but for the benefit of his community.

Now, as Kirk ventures beyond the Plains of Nall into the wider world as an adventurer, he carries with him the teachings of his upbringing: the strength of his people, the wisdom of his father, and the unyielding spirit of a warrior forged in the crucible of the open plains.

Relic: Mask Of the Gnolls

This relic has two identical masks in the form of a Gnoll. Found By Kurt Marshaven during his research of the Gnoll wars. Adorned with the marking of the Mudhallow Tribe

embedded image

When both users invest into this item they gain the following benefits.

When Connected to Kurt:

Kirk is able to add his will into the mask connecting him to Kurt and trade places with him as a free action (once per day) used to help protect Kurt in dire situations where Kirks strength is needed but only when they psychically agree to trade places.

Kirk is able to understand and speak all of Kurt's known language. This helps Kirk when working at the brothel.

If the mask is removed while kirk is in combat, Kirk will be transported back unable to trade places until the next 24 hours.

Note: the masks removal and teleportation is not considered common knowledge to Party members currently.

Kirk is unable to transport items (normal or magical) with him unless they are invested.

They share a psychic link when wearing the mask, knowing how the other feels and experiencing each others past when activating the mask.
